What is the Y interpret of the question? y=-1/2x-6​
Oduvanchick [21]

Answer:

The y-intercept is (0,-6)

Step-by-step explanation:

In the equation y = mx + b, b is the y-intercept. In your equation, the b is -6, so the y-intercept is (0,-6).
